摘要

Fatigue crack propagation was studied under random flight simulation loading and two types of programmed flight sequences. Tests were carried out on 2024-T3 Alclad specimens. Fractographic observations were made to determine the severity of individual flight types. Altogether up to 7 different flight types from a total of 10 types could be distinguished on the fatigue failure surfaces, and the severity on the basis of results of crack extension measurements was determined.
